ISLAMABAD (INP): The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) is examining the Paradise Leaks papers, said a spokesperson from the organisation on Monday.
The papers mention the names of 135 Pakistani nationals, including former prime minister Shaukat Aziz.
Pakistanis, whose name has appeared in the latest data dump of financial papers, will be issued a notice in the regard.
The spokesperson added that the list of names is extensive and all those Pakistani nationals named in the papers will be investigated, added the FBR statement.
